Discussions here and here of 'films you have walked out on'. Some people have picked idiotic examples, like Reservoir Dogs or Groundhog Day.

I've left the cinema before the film finished a few times:

'Never Say Never Again' (James Bond film) because I was a young snob - though it really was a crap film

'Eraserhead' because I was going to faint

'The Tin Drum' because I was going to faint (I went back in later)

'Pan's Labyrinth' because I did faint (went back another day)

I didn't walk out of Van Helsing, I just fell asleep.
